Abstract
We propose a 3D arrangement of thumbnail images for the purpose of browsing a single video file. The thumbnail images are linearly extracted from the video and used as textures for bended screens in a 3D-ring arrangement, which act as links for the playback of the corresponding video segments. Furthermore, the thumbnail images in this 3D-ring are intuitively organized by their dominant colors according to the HSV color space. This color-based organization should help users to estimate the position of a known item in the 3D-ring.
